The ingredients needed to make Green olive tapenade:
  1. Prepare 10 stoned large green olives (or 15 small ones)
  2. Get 1/4 tsp capers
  3. Get 1/4 tsp ground almonds
  4. Prepare 1/4 garlic clove crushed
  5. Take 1 tbls evoo
  6. Make ready Pinch ground cumin
  7. Prepare Pinch ground paprika

Steps to make Green olive tapenade:
  1. Purée all ingredients in food processor, or bash together with a pestle and mortar.

Green Olive Tapenade is an easy recipe made from a combination of olives and other ingredients. Traditionally this recipe uses 'green olives' not black or kalamata. Commonly found as an appetizer or spread, it often has anchovies, capers, garlic and parsley in it.
